What Are Marketing Qualified Leads?
Businesses need to find Marketing Qualified Leads (MQLs) to grow. MQLs show interest in what a company offers. They are more likely to become customers.
Definition and Essential Characteristics
MQLs are leads that show they’re interested and fit the company’s ideal customer. They have:
- Specific behaviors like downloading content or attending webinars.
- Demographic info that matches the company’s target audience.
- Engagement metrics showing they’re interested in what the company offers.
The Distinction Between MQLs, SQLs, and General Leads
It’s important to know the difference between MQLs, Sales Qualified Leads (SQLs), and general leads. General leads show some interest. MQLs show more interest and are ready for sales outreach. SQLs are leads the sales team has checked and are ready for a direct conversation.
Behavioral Indicators
Behavioral signs for MQLs include:
- Visiting the company website often.
- Engaging with valuable content.
- Trying out free trials or demos.
Engagement Metrics
Metrics that show a lead is an MQL include:
- Email open rates and click-through rates.
- Social media engagement.
- Content downloads and views.

Implementing an Effective Lead Scoring System
To get the most out of Marketing Qualified Leads (MQLs), businesses need a strong lead scoring system. Lead scoring helps find MQLs by looking at who they are and what they do. This way, businesses can see which leads are most likely to buy.
Demographic vs. Behavioral Scoring Models
There are two main ways to score leads: demographic and behavioral. Demographic scoring looks at things like job title and company size. Behavioral scoring checks how leads act, like visiting websites or downloading content. Using both gives a full picture of leads.
Explicit vs. Implicit Scoring Criteria
Lead scoring can use explicit or implicit criteria. Explicit criteria asks leads directly through forms or surveys. Implicit criteria tracks how leads behave and interact. Both are key for a good lead scoring system.
Progressive Profiling Techniques
Progressive profiling collects more info about leads as they move through the sales funnel. It asks for more details as leads go further.
Form Strategy
A good form strategy is vital for progressive profiling. Businesses must find a balance between getting enough info and not scaring off leads.
Data Enrichment Methods
Data enrichment adds more info to lead data from outside sources. This helps businesses understand their leads better and score them more accurately.

Measuring and Optimizing Your MQL Strategy
Measuring and improving your MQL strategy is key to sales success today. You must track important metrics, use attribution modeling, and keep testing and tweaking your methods.
Essential KPIs for MQL Performance
To see how well your MQL strategy works, look at these important KPIs:
- Conversion rates from lead to opportunity
- Lead velocity – how fast leads move through your sales funnel
- Lead quality scores based on set criteria
- Cost per lead and return on investment (ROI) for lead generation campaigns
Attribution Modeling Approaches
Attribution modeling shows how marketing touches lead to conversions. You can use:
- Last-touch attribution
- First-touch attribution
- Multi-touch attribution models that look at all interactions
A/B Testing Frameworks for Continuous Improvement
A/B testing is vital for bettering your MQL strategy. Focus on:
Conversion Rate Optimization
Test different parts of your landing pages, forms, and calls-to-action to boost conversion rates.
Lead Quality Assessment
Keep checking and improving your lead scoring models to find top-quality leads.
